CRL.M.C.998/2021
3. Vide the present petition, petitioner seeks direction thereby for quashing of FIR No.110/2018 dated 28.04.2018, registered at PS - Rani Bagh (North West), and all other proceedings arising therefrom.
4. Notice issued.
5. Notice is accepted by learned APP for State and by counsel for respondent no.2 and with the consent of counsel for parties, the present petition is taken up for final disposal.

6. The present petition is filed on the ground that parties have settled their disputes and respondent Nos. 2 and 3 have no objection if the present petition is allowed.
7. Learned APP has opposed the present petition by submitting that there are 2 accused in the present case and this petition is qua petitioner herein. He further submits that due to the registration of FIR, government machinery came in motion and a lot of precious public time has been consumed, therefore, if this Court is inclined to quash FIR, heavy cost may be imposed upon petitioner.
8. Respondent Nos.2 & 3 are personally present in Court with learned counsel and they have been identified by SI Ankit Man/IO and submits that matter has been settled and they do not wish to prosecute the matter any further.
9. Petitioner and respondent nos.2 & 3 with the intervention of their well wishers and relatives entered into an amicable settlement vide settlement deed dated 25.10.2019.
10. At this stage, learned counsel for petitioner, on instructions from petitioner, who is present in Court, has come forward and agreed to contribute an amount of ₹5,00,000/- for welfare purposes. Accordingly, CRL.M.C.998/2021 Page 2 of 3 petitioner is directed to pay this amount in the following manner:-
(a) Petitioner is directed to pay an amount of Rs.1,00,000/- in favour of Delhi Police Martyrs Fund;
(b) He is again directed to pay an amount of Rs.2,00,000/- in favour of 'Bharat ke Veer'.
(c) He is further directed to pay an amount of Rs.2,00,000/- in favour of the High Court of Delhi (Middle Income Group) Legal Aid Society.
11. Petitioner is directed to pay this amount within one week and receipt of the same shall be furnished to IO concerned.
12. Taking into account the aforesaid facts, this Court is inclined to quash FIR as no useful purpose would be served in prosecuting petitioner any further.
13. For the reasons afore-recorded, FIR No.110/2018 dated 28.04.2018, registered at PS - Rani Bagh (North West), and consequent proceedings emanating therefrom are quashed.
14. The petition is, accordingly, allowed and disposed of.
